你查询的IP:[114.80.196.172]  地理位置:中国–上海–上海电信/IDC机房

最新查询119.3.152.80 117.106.216.165 117.48.204.85 117.24.190.24 123.52.43.122 60.247.128.51 117.57.171.23 120.30.99.7 123.8.45.7 114.80.196.172 116.204.198.96 117.76.204.65 58.144.141.137 118.84.170.221 119.10.142.66 221.192.16.33 116.56.170.36 122.136.79.11 123.128.228.120 202.136.48.125 123.138.250.172 125.64.84.46 202.38.164.114 202.141.160.25 122.240.57.243 61.8.160.110 210.51.181.185 198.17.7.179 123.96.160.44 221.13.188.17 219.224.65.80